Attending a job fair or career expo can be a great opportunity to connect with potential employers and land your dream job. Proper preparation is essential to make a strong impression and maximize your chances of success. Here are some key steps to help you prepare effectively.
Research the Companies
Before the event, review the list of participating companies. Visit their websites to understand their mission, products, and recent news. This knowledge will help you tailor your conversations and demonstrate genuine interest.
Update Your Resume and Portfolio
Ensure your resume is current, error-free, and tailored to the types of positions you’re seeking. Bring multiple copies to distribute to recruiters. If applicable, prepare a digital portfolio showcasing your work.
Practice Your Elevator Pitch
Develop a brief, compelling summary of your background, skills, and career goals. Practice delivering it confidently, so you can introduce yourself effectively during conversations with recruiters.
Dress Professionally
Choose professional attire appropriate for your industry. First impressions matter, so ensure your outfit is clean, well-fitted, and suitable for a formal setting.
Prepare Questions and Follow-Up Materials
Prepare thoughtful questions to ask recruiters about their company culture, job openings, and next steps. Bring business cards or contact information to exchange, and consider writing thank-you notes after the event.
Attend the Event with Confidence
Arrive early, stay engaged, and be proactive in approaching recruiters. Maintain good eye contact, listen actively, and showcase your enthusiasm for the opportunities available.
Follow Up After the Fair
Send personalized thank-you emails to the contacts you met. Reinforce your interest in the company and highlight how your skills align with their needs. This follow-up can help you stand out from other candidates.
